What is Lightweight Backpacking?

Lightweight backpacking is an increasingly popular approach to outdoor recreation that has gained traction among hikers and backpackers alike. It involves the art of packing smarter and lighter, with the goal of reducing pack weight while maintaining safety, comfort, and overall enjoyment of the experience.

The movement began in the 1960s, with hikers and backpackers exploring ways to reduce the weight of their gear while maintaining its necessary functionality. Since then, it has evolved into a popular philosophy, with a range of gear and strategies designed to help reduce pack weight.

The primary aim of lightweight backpacking is to reduce the weight of your backpack without compromising on necessary gear. A lighter pack enables hikers to cover more ground with less fatigue, making the entire experience more enjoyable. The goal isn’t to leave behind essential gear or to be unprepared for emergencies, but rather to choose lightweight, efficient, and reliable gear.

To achieve this, lightweight backpackers adhere to several key principles, including simplifying gear choices, reducing pack weight, and focusing on multi-use items. Many follow the “big three” principle, concentrating on reducing the weight of their three most critical items: backpack, shelter, and sleeping system.

Lightweight backpackers also consider the weight and functionality of every item they pack, preferring gear made with lightweight and durable materials, such as titanium or carbon fiber. They also choose clothing and footwear that are specifically designed for outdoor activities.

The benefits of lightweight backpacking are numerous. Hikers can cover more ground with less fatigue, reducing the risk of injury and allowing them to enjoy the scenery and wildlife. A lighter pack also reduces the impact on the environment, as it puts less strain on trails and campsites. Additionally, lightweight backpacking gear is often more versatile and multi-use, reducing the number of items that hikers need to carry.

What Makes a Good Lightweight Stove?

When choosing a lightweight backpacking stove, there are some important factors to consider to determine its quality. Here are some key elements to look for:

Weight: The weight of a backpacking stove is a crucial factor. An excellent stove should be lightweight and easy to carry to keep hikers’ backpack weight down.

Efficiency: A high-quality backpacking stove should be efficient, using minimal fuel to cook meals and boil water. It is recommended to look for stoves that can boil water quickly and maintain a steady flame.

Durability: As the stove will likely be subjected to a variety of conditions, durability is an essential consideration. A durable stove can withstand wear and tear and endure a range of outdoor environments.

Stability: Stability is an essential factor when selecting a lightweight backpacking stove. A good stove should have a solid base and pot supports that offer stability on uneven or rocky terrain.

Simplicity: An excellent backpacking stove should be simple and easy to use, with a minimal setup and maintenance process required.

Compatibility: Finally, the stove’s compatibility with fuel canisters is an essential factor to consider. Before buying, ensure that the stove is compatible with the type of fuel you plan to use on your trip.

By taking these factors into account, backpackers can choose a lightweight backpacking stove that meets their needs and makes cooking meals on the trail more comfortable and hassle-free.

Top 5 Best Lightweight Backpacking Stoves

  • Jetboil Flash Cooking System: This cooking system is designed for backpackers who need quick and efficient meals. It is lightweight, weighing only 13.1 ounces, and can boil water in just 100 seconds. The push-button ignition and neoprene cozy keep your food and drinks warm. The cooking cup has a 1-liter capacity and a color-changing heat indicator. It also comes with a fuel canister stabilizer and tripod base.   • MSR PocketRocket 2 Stove: The MSR PocketRocket 2 Stove is an excellent choice for backpackers who want a reliable, lightweight stove. It weighs only 2.6 ounces and can boil a liter of water in just 3.5 minutes. The PocketRocket 2 features a durable design, with a sturdy pot support and serrated burner.   • Snow Peak LiteMax Stove: The Snow Peak LiteMax Stove is a lightweight and efficient stove, weighing only 1.9 ounces. The compact design makes it easy to pack in your backpack, and it can boil a liter of water in just 4.25 minutes. The stove has a sturdy pot support and a wide base that provides stability on uneven terrain. It also features a regulator that ensures a consistent flame, even in cold or windy conditions.
